Q: Is 485,507 a Prime Number?
A: No, 485,507 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 485507 can be evenly divided by 1 11 19 23 101 209 253 437 1,111 1,919 2,323 4,807 21,109 25,553 44,137 and 485,507, with no remainder.
Since 485,507 cannot be divided by just 1 and 485,507, it is not a prime number.
